First, check yr wheel balancing. If its ok, then are u using aftermarket rims? U might need a center cone. My problem solved when I used the center cone to fill the gaps between the rim n yr wheel hub.

I had experience with bent drive shaft before. When it starts to wobble, it won't stop. It will get worse as you drive faster. So I don't think so.

When I upgraded my rims from original to 18", the shop guy asked me to put on the ring to fill the gap between the center hub and rim to avoid vibration, I did not believe him cos it wasn't not cheap. True enough, the rim vibrates from 110kph - 120kph. ANy speed before and after, it was stable, even above 180kph.

Then I got the ring installed and it resolved the problem altogether.

Best of all, the spacer I use to clear my front caliper has exactly the same gap like the center hub, so the ring works with the spacer too. :)
